Woodworking Tools : How to Use a Wood Turning Lathe

by Lathe on Oct.31, 2009, under Lathe Videos

In order to use a wood lathe, lock a piece of wood into the head stock and tail stock, start the tool at its slowest speed and support the tool with the blade in hand. Learn how to rotate the chisel when using a wood turning lathe withhelp from an experienced woodworker in this free video on woodworking tools.
